Computer >> คอมพิวเตอร์ >  >> การเขียนโปรแกรม >> PHP

ฟังก์ชัน ftell() ใน PHP


ฟังก์ชัน ftell() ส่งกลับตำแหน่งปัจจุบันในไฟล์ที่เปิดอยู่ ฟังก์ชันส่งคืนตำแหน่งตัวชี้ไฟล์ปัจจุบัน หากล้มเหลว ระบบจะส่งคืน FALSE

ไวยากรณ์

ftell(file_pointer)

พารามิเตอร์

  • file_pointer - ตัวชี้ไฟล์ที่สร้างขึ้นโดยใช้ fopen() จำเป็น

คืนสินค้า

ฟังก์ชัน ftell() ส่งกลับตำแหน่งตัวชี้ไฟล์ปัจจุบัน หากล้มเหลว ระบบจะส่งคืน FALSE

ตัวอย่าง

<?php
   $file_pointer = fopen("new.txt","r");
   echo ftell($file_pointer);
   fclose($file_pointer);
?>

ผลลัพธ์

0

เรามาดูตัวอย่างกันที่ตำแหน่งปัจจุบันมีการเปลี่ยนแปลง

ตัวอย่าง

<?php
   $file_pointer = fopen("new.txt","r");
   // changing current position
   fseek($file_pointer,"10");
   // displaying current position
   echo ftell($file_pointer);
   fclose($file_pointer);
?>

ต่อไปนี้เป็นผลลัพธ์ ตำแหน่งปัจจุบันจะถูกส่งคืน

ผลลัพธ์

10